Jay-Z On VH1 Storytellers
VH1 Storytellers: Jay-Z: Life of an American Gangster" premieres tonight at 9 p.m. The hour-long concert, recorded Oct. 24 at Steiner Studios in Brooklyn, features Jay-Z performing eight songs off of his new Roc-A-Fella album, "American Gangster," which is inspired by the film of the same name.
Jay-Z is backed by a 12-piece band and a large projection screen which surrounds the stage as he performs, enveloping him in imagery that relates both literally and figuratively to the lyrics in his songs.
Following in "Storytellers" format, viewers will hear Jay-Z discuss the inspiration and stories behind each of the songs performed, which include "Pray," "Dreamin," "Roc Boys," "Sweet," "Party Life," "I Know," "Fallin,"
and "Blue Magic."
